Comments
Driven by Yvan Muller for the opening two rounds of the 2005 BTCC before being converted to a two-seater and used for demos. Muller would switch to V2005-016 for the remainder of the season.

The car continued to be used as the team's demo vehicle until mid-2006 when it was raced by Turkish driver Erkut Kizilirmak for 2 rounds of the BTCC.

Following Kizilirmak's races, the car was converted back to a two-seater.

The car was added to Vauxhall Heritage Collection at Vauxhall Motors in Luton during 2010.

Vehicle kept in open storage from 2015 until sold to Simon Bloomfield in 2017.

Acquired by the Morgan family in 2024.
